As worries regarding environment modification and environmental sustainability grow, the logistics market is increasingly focusing on minimizing its carbon footprint. Business are taking on different methods to end up being much more environmentally friendly, from green supply chain practices to the use of electric cars and advancements in product packaging and waste decrease. These initiatives are vital not only for environmental stewardship but also for meeting the climbing need for lasting methods from consumers and regulatory authorities.

Environment-friendly Supply Chain Practices

2. Improved Transportation Courses: Advanced innovation for optimizing routes aids logistics firms in minimizing gas usage and emissions via figuring out the most reliable shipment paths. Making use of advanced algorithms and current info enables on-the-fly changes to paths to steer clear of traffic and reduce waiting periods.

Collective Logistics involves business working together to share transport resources and framework, which can lead to a decrease in the quantity of cars in operation and a succeeding decrease in emissions. This technique fosters collaborations among organizations to integrate shipments and optimize load ability, eventually reducing the ecological footprint.

Utilising Electric Automobiles

1. Transitioning to electric-powered delivery automobiles is a significant turning point in the effort to lessen the environmental effect of the logistics industry. Considering that they do not release any type of exhaust emissions, these environment-friendly trucks dramatically decrease greenhouse gas discharges when compared to their diesel-powered equivalents. Leading logistics firms are taking the effort to switch over to electric fleets and are additionally establishing the essential supporting framework, including the setup of charging points.

2. Urban Distribution Solutions: Electric bicycles and vans are getting popularity for final distribution in urban setups. These modes of transportation are excellent for short ranges and busy city streets, inevitably decreasing both air and sound pollution. Major business such as Amazon and UPS are presently try out electrical freight bicycles to enhance urban shipments.

3. Governments worldwide are giving financial inspiration to urge the uptake of electric automobiles, including exemptions from taxes, moneying allocations, and discounted prices. These motivators make the shift to electric-powered logistics a lot more monetarily sustainable for firms in the market. Moreover, federal governments' significantly strict policies on air pollution are driving companies to purchase eco-friendly technologies.

Advancements in Product Packaging and Waste Reduction

1. Sustainable Product Packaging Products: Reducing the environmental influence of packaging is a vital facet of sustainable logistics. Companies are moving in the direction of biodegradable, recyclable, and recyclable products. As an example, biodegradable packaging made from plant-based products lowers reliance on plastics and reduces land fill waste.

2. Product Packaging Efficiency: Enhancing packaging design can assist business reduce the dimension and weight of deliveries, causing lowered transport emissions. 3. Waste Reduction Initiatives: Presenting waste decrease programs throughout the supply chain works in lowering the ecological impact. These campaigns incorporate recycling schemes, composting practices, and the adoption of reusable packaging. Businesses are increasingly emphasizing the reduction of food wastage in the transportation of perishable goods by enhancing inventory control and using technical options to track and extend the freshness of products.
